A Compact Powerhouse for Physical AI and Robotics The NVIDIA® Jetson AGX Thor™ Developer Kit gives you unmatched performance and scalability. It’s powered by the NVIDIA Blackwell GPU and 128 GB of memory, delivering up to 2070 FP4 TFLOPS of AI compute to effortlessly run the latest generative AI models—all within a 130 W power envelope. Compared to NVIDIA Jetson AGX Orin™, it provides up to 7.5x higher AI compute and 3.5x better energy efficiency. Jetson AGX Thor helps you accelerate low-latency, real-time applications with the new Blackwell Multi-Instance GPU (MIG) technology and a robust 14-core Arm® Neoverse®-V3AE CPU. It also includes a suite of accelerators, including a thirdgeneration Programmable Vision Accelerator (PVA), dual encoders and decoders, an optical flow accelerator, and more. For high-speed sensor fusion, the developer kit offers extensive I/O options, including a QSFP slot with 4x25 GbE, a wired Multi-GbE RJ45 connector, multiple USB ports, and additional connectivity interfaces. Plus, it’s designed for seamless integration with existing humanoid robot platforms, allowing for easy tethering to jumpstart prototyping
Jetson AGX Thor belongs to a new class of robotic computers, architected from the ground up to power next-generation humanoid robots. It supports a wide range of generative AI models, from Vision Language Action (VLA) models like NVIDIA Isaac™ GR00T N to all popular LLMs and VLMs. To deliver a seamless cloud-to-edge experience, Jetson AGX Thor runs the NVIDIA AI software stack for physical AI applications, including NVIDIA Isaac for robotics, NVIDIA Metropolis for visual agentic AI, and NVIDIA Holoscan for sensor processing. You can also build AI agents at the edge using NVIDIA agentic AI workflows like Video Search and Summarization (VSS).
